The lining of the small intestine is covered with tiny projections with many capillaries. The projections are called villi. Nutrients pass into the capillaries of the villi and then to other organs of the body.
There are tiny, hairlike structures on the wall of the intestines called villi, and they are responsible for nutrient absorption.
